Official abstract text for this publication.
A solar cell module comprises: a solar cell panel; a terminal box mounted to the back surface of the solar cell panel, which is one surface thereof; a frame mounted to the edges of the solar cell panel; and a metallic first cover composed of a base section for covering the back surface of the terminal box, which is one surface thereof, and of an affixation section affixed to a frame which composes the frame.
